9. ProjectorView (ProjectorView enabled projectors only)

ProjectorView is a web-browser based remote control and monitoring tool for network projectors.
ProjectorView is not available when using other than the projectors listed on page 30.
For more information on ProjectorView, see the LAN Control Utility manual that comes with the projector.

9.1. Starting ProjectorView

(1) Select the projector that you want to operate from the list of projectors on the main screen.
• Start ProjectorView for one projector at a time. You cannot concurrently use ProjectorView for multiple
projectors.
(2) Click [ProjectorView] in the tool bar on the main screen.
• The Web browser launches automatically. The password entry window is then displayed.
<Note>
• You can start ProjectorView by manually typing the projector IP address in your web browser's address
bar.
• If you are using a proxy server, do not enable proxy settings when accessing the projector IP address.
• Up to three ProjectorView units can be used to control a single projector.
(3) Enter the password and click [OK]. (The default password is "admin".)
• "ProjectorView" main window is displayed.
<Note>
• The connection will turn off in fi ve minutes after the password entry window is displayed. You cannot enter
the password then. If this happens, restart the ProjectorView.
